Home Rehab: ConditioningVHRC offers conditioning sessions for your athletic pet. This is a great supplement to your at-home training throughout the year, and is especially important during the winter months where inclement weather may affect the frequency and quality of your pet's work-outs. Sessions include the underwater treadmill (which has an optional incline for increased rear end strengthening, and 6 jets for added resistance), a flat land treadmill, or an inclined land treadmill. Leg weights (from ¼ lb to 2 lbs) and back packs (filled with weights) can be added into your pet's work-out sessions for additional strengthening. Goals of Conditioning:

A pre-conditioning exam is required to ensure there are no pre-existing medical conditions that could affect your pet's health and safety during his/her work-outs. This can be performed by Dr. Danoff or your primary veterinarian and must be completed within the last 12 months for animals 7 years and under, and within the last 6 months if older than 7 years. |
